Shortly before passing their tax bill, Senate Republicans removed a provision that would have allowed tax breaks for “unborn children,” a top GOP aide confirmed on Monday.
The proposal “on unborn children was not included in the measure that passed the Senate,” said Julia Lawless, a spokeswoman for Senate Finance Chairman Orrin Hatch.
